The equation 3x=3x+5 has no solution, whereas the equation 7x+8=8 has zero as a solution. Explain the difference between a solution of zero and no solution.



Answer:

Consider the first equation.....

3x=3x+5
Solution of this equation means value of 'x' which satisfies the given equation...that means when you plugg the value of 'x' in the given equation, it will satisfy the equation.....


lets try to solve this equation...


subtract 3x from both sides of the equation....(because here you have to retain the x term in one side all the constant term in the other side)

3x - 3x =3x + 5 - 3x

==> 0 = 0 + 5
here the term containg 'x got eliminated because both sides having the same x terms.....

so we cannot proceed further.....
so we can say that this equation has no solution......



Now consider the second equation.....


7x+8=8

subtract 8 from both sides.....(because here you have to retain the x term in one side all the constant term in the other side)



7x + 8 - 8 = 8 - 8


==> 7x = 0


Now divide both sides by 7.....


==>


==> x = 0, because when we divide 0 by 7, the answer is 0



So we can say that here the value of x is 0


That is solution is 0.
